Instant reaction: I like taking the 3 points.

I think everyone is concerned about the Cats’ road record (Lee Corso included; he picked Cal on Gameday). However, I think our two road losses aren’t necessarily proof of Arizona being a bad road team.

The Iowa game was tough for various reasons. Early in the season. Matt Scott’s struggles at QB before Sunshine took over. And a couple bad plays given up on defense.

The Washington game, well….we all know what happened there. A couple tough calls, and a failure to close a team out led to that loss.

I think this game will be tight, but Foles has shown some maturity on the road (including a huge win in Corvallis). If the offensive line can keep Foles upright and we neutralize Cal’s rushing attack, we should have a great shot at a huge road victory.

Here’s hoping the team isn’t looking past Cal to next week’s matchup with Oregon.
